Understanding Precision Scheduling: The Basics

Precision scheduling is an advanced method of planning and managing processes that ensures optimal resource utilization and minimizes downtime. It involves the meticulous planning and execution of tasks, taking into account real-time data and feedback to ensure that every step of the process operates at peak efficiency. # Key Components of Precision Scheduling

- Real-Time Data Integration: Utilizing live data to make informed decisions.

- Predictive Analytics: Anticipating future needs and adjusting schedules accordingly.

- Automated Adjustments: Systems that can independently modify schedules based on current conditions.

- Resource Optimization: Maximizing the use of available resources without overburdening them.

Case Study: Automotive Manufacturing

Imagine a scenario where an automotive manufacturer faces a critical deadline for a high-demand model. Without precision scheduling, the company could face significant delays and increased costs. By implementing precision scheduling, the manufacturer can:

- Predict Potential Bottlenecks: Anticipate where delays might occur and take proactive measures to mitigate them.

- Optimize Resource Allocation: Ensure that critical components are available when needed, without overstocking.

- Streamline Production Flow: Smooth out the production line to maintain a steady flow of work, reducing downtime.

In a real-world application, a leading automotive company successfully implemented precision scheduling for their assembly lines. By integrating real-time data and predictive analytics, they were able to reduce production delays by 30% and improve overall efficiency by 25%. This case study underscores the tangible benefits of precision scheduling in a highly competitive industry.

Practical Applications in Other Industries

Precision scheduling is not limited to manufacturing; its applications span across various sectors, including healthcare, logistics, and construction.

# Healthcare: Scheduling Patient Appointments

In healthcare, precision scheduling can revolutionize patient care by:

- Minimizing Wait Times: Ensuring that patients are seen promptly, reducing their wait times.

- Enhancing Staff Utilization: Optimizing the use of medical staff to handle peak patient volumes efficiently.

- Improving Patient Satisfaction: Streamlining the scheduling process to provide a more seamless experience for patients.

A hospital implemented precision scheduling to manage patient appointments more effectively. By analyzing historical data and using predictive analytics, they were able to reduce wait times by 20% and improve patient satisfaction scores significantly.

# Logistics: Optimizing Supply Chain Operations

For logistics companies, precision scheduling can mean the difference between timely deliveries and missed deadlines. By:

- Efficient Routing: Planning the most optimal routes for delivery vehicles.

- Real-Time Tracking: Monitoring shipments in real-time to address any issues promptly.

- Resource Allocation: Ensuring that all necessary resources are available at the right time and place.

A major logistics firm improved its delivery times by 15% and reduced fuel costs by 10% after adopting precision scheduling practices. This example highlights how precision scheduling can enhance operational efficiency and cost-effectiveness.
